Urban (city) management with the emphasis on ‘CDS approach in central cities, of Iran
Journal Title: Journal of Science and today’s world - Year 2015, Vol 4, Issue 8
Abstract
Managing a city, would not be possible, without management. City development has compelled the designers, programmers, and the experts of the city (urban) issue, to study more about the different dimensions of developing urban areas and the analysis of the different city management, in order to present new solution. Big cities, on the one hand, with regards to their population and density, have especial complexities in city management and control. And on the other hand, small and central cities, are also faced with difficulties, and problems. Therefore, if they don’t take action to resolve these issues with programmers in the targeted way, the country’s city management group will be more blind at the national, regional and the local level. To help create participatory decision-making processes in developing countries and central cities in order to reduce urban poverty and ensuring sustainable development, the coalition of cities organization, promotes the city development strategy as an effective tool. This study was conducted on quantitative analytical method. The objective of this article is to use the city development strategy in the management of central cities, for the elimination of crises, challenges and urban issues in developing counties, including Iran. To conclude, strengthening and development of small and middle cities, can be regarded as appropriate strategies for the balance of the spatial system of urban network of the country and can orient the urban network system, in a harmonious and rational trend. This will only be achieved with appropriate management system in all the pillars of the city and due to the potentials and talents of small and middle cities. In this regard, familiarities with new urban and regional planning tools, including the strategy of city development to improve the management of middle cities, is a new approach that if there is a suitable substrate, it can definitely produce beneficial results for the central cities in developing countries, including Iran.
